    Brent M.

    Warm rustic charm filled with authentic and comforting French pastries and cuisine. Everywhere your eyes reach will take you to the French countryside and each bite will seal the reality of the experience. Walking the streets of Old Town Santa Fe, you wouldn't think this is possible. But sit down in front of the large fire place, order the quiche or sandwich of your choice. We loved the flaking of the quiche pastry and savoriness of the fillings. We also had Croque Madam and baguette sandwich with the onion soup. We enjoyed the personal touch of our server who made us feel like regulars coming to visit a long-time friend at work. We couldn't leave until we had a box full of pastries to try later and it was all we could do to not consume them all in one sitting. Thanks for the comforting afternoon.

    Alexandra D.

    Being from Europe, pastries for me are a must and mainly I appreciate when I find a shop who can craft a good pastry without all the excessive sugar. The napoleon was perfect. Crispy layers of phyllo with a subtle vanilla custard cream.. yummy! Don't worry about manners and just bite into it, a fork will not do it any justice lol The black Forrest cake was also very well made. A little on the sweeter side for my taste but with the addition of the cherries inside it made for a delicious dessert. The place was packed so we took these to go, grabbed a few utensils and sat at a nearby park to enjoy them. They also serve coffee and other savory treats for your delight whether is morning breakfast hours or an afternoon sweet treats.

    Joanna L.

    Starting the morning off right! We came in on a Sunday at around 10:45AM. Located right in Santa Fe plaza, the place was bustling, but we were lucky enough to get the last table. Alternatively, you can order pastries and coffee to go. The shop itself is cozy and has antique-like decorations. The staff was very friendly. We ordered the savory chicken mushroom spinach crepe and the roast beef sandwich on a baguette, along with a latte and a mocha. The coffee was your typical latte and mocha, and I enjoyed it. The baguette sandwich is also your typical sandwich, although I did enjoy the freshness and softness of the bread. But what I LOVE was the crepe! Folded like a manila envelope, the bechemel sauce paired SO WELL with the chicken mushroom and spinach. Each bite was so satisfying. From the menu items we ordered specifically, this is a satisfactory cafe which will definitely fill you up for the rest of the day. I will say -- the pastries looked absolutely phenomenal, and I would definitely order that next time to satisfy my sweet tooth. Reliable pastry shop in a fantastic location -- worth the experience!

    John D.

    Brings me back to my time in Europe. After a good meal we'd end up at one of the local cafés for dessert and coffee. Of course those cafés didn't have a 100 year history. This café is dimly lit, antique chairs, tables & benches and a well used hearth. The pastries are much fresher. It was late in the day, not much left in the case. But enough for us. It was their Opera (layers of mocha coffee, chocolate & sponge cake) a nice low level of sweetness & moist. Chai Tea - smooth & not overly sweet and a mocha once again not too sweet. Service was meh, but dessert was good.
